| Notes | Caption beneath image when it appeared in the Renton Historical Quarterly: The USO at Renton saw many occasions for celebration, here in 1945 is one such event. Shown here, left to right, is an unidentified sailor, Evana Omaits (Flynn), Jo Krezak, another sailor, Milli Omaits (Whiting), Norma White, and an unidentified woman just about to cut the cake.
Handwritten on verso: U.S.O. Renton, Washington, 1945. Evana Omaits (Flynn), Jo Kresak, Bill Jackson, Milli Omaits (Whiting) and Norma White. |
